# Translate your pages into other languages
Reach international customers by translating your Foxify pages into any language your store supports — auto-translate everything in one click with Fox Magic, or refine the wording and tone by hand.

## How to translate your pages
1. From the Foxify Dashboard, go to **Translation**.
2. Click **Manage languages** in the top-right corner.
3. Click **Add language**, select a language from the dropdown, then click **Add language** to confirm.

Don't see the language you need? Click **Store languages** in the same dialog to enable it in Shopify first.
Once added, use the **Manage languages** table to track each language's Status, Auto update setting, Last updated time, and Progress.
On the **Localize content** screen, browse by group and click into any item to open it for translation:
* Pages & templates: Home page, Products, Collections, Pages, Blog posts, Cart, Password, 404 page, and more
* Sections: Theme sections, Layout templates, Foxify Header & Footer
* Other: Default Foxify theme content
1. Use the **Translating \[Language]** dropdown to confirm which language you're editing, and the type dropdown (e.g. **Home page**) to switch page type.

2. In the left sidebar, select the specific template — search by name if there are several.

3. Each field appears as a row (grouped by section, e.g. **Section -> Frame**, **Section -> Stack**) with the source text on the left and an editable field for your translation on the right, each showing a character count.

## Auto-translate
1. In the Localize content editor, click **Auto-translate** (top right).
2. Choose target content: **All empty fields** (fills in untranslated fields only) or **All empty fields and existing translations** (also overwrites fields you've already translated).
3. **Don't translate custom code** is checked by default — uncheck it if you want custom code translated too.
4. Click **Translate \[Language]** to confirm.

Already translated some fields by hand? Auto-translate defaults to filling only empty fields, so your manual edits are safe. Choose **All empty fields and existing translations** only if you want to overwrite them.

## Translate Foxify's default wording
**Default Foxify theme content** is the standard system text Foxify ships with — labels like Cart, Log in, Log out, and Account. It's not tied to a single page: editing it here updates that wording everywhere it appears across your Foxify pages.
1. Under **Other** on the Localize content screen, open **Default Foxify theme content**.
2. Use the language dropdown (top right) to pick the language you're editing.
3. Browse by tab and category to find the wording you want, or use **Search**.
4. Edit the field directly. Changes save per field.
## Known limitations
* Up to **3,400 translated strings** per template, per language
* Each individual translated value can be up to **1,000 characters**
These limits come from Shopify's theme [locale file requirements](https://shopify.dev/docs/storefronts/themes/architecture/locales#requirements-and-limitations).
## FAQs
**Will Auto-translate overwrite fields I already translated by hand?**
Not by default. Auto-translate targets only empty fields unless you specifically choose **All empty fields and existing translations** in the Auto-translate dialog.
**Does auto-translating cost anything?**
Yes — Auto-translate runs on Fox Magic credits, and the dialog shows how many credits the job will use before you confirm. See [All about credit](https://docs.foxecom.com/foxify-app/ai-powered-fox-magic/all-about-credit).
**What's the difference between translating page content and changing the default Foxify wording?**
Page content is your own text — headlines, product copy, and so on — inside one specific page. Default Foxify theme content is the built-in system wording — edit it once, and it updates everywhere that wording appears across your Foxify pages.
